Plot:
The year is 2009 and Minister of Culture Lena Adelsohn Liljeroth storms out of the Market art fair in Stockholm. The reason: "Territorial pissing", a two-minute film in which a man dressed in black, armed with a spray can, goes on a rampage in a subway car. The work was Magnus "NUG" Gustafsson's thesis from Konstfack and the debate about art versus vandalism raged for weeks afterwards. Long before that, NUG was a legend among graffiti painters but was, after the Minister of Culture's statement, considered a fascinating provocateur and one of Sweden's hottest artist names. With the help of stories from painters, ministers, art dealers, falcons and art historians, NUG - Vandal in Motion not only tells the story of the artist NUG but also takes a firm grip on the debate about urban and public art in general.
